Topics Covered
- 1. Introduction to Real-Time Simulation Environments: Learners will understand the basics of real-time simulation environments and their applications. They will gain foundational knowledge in setting up and understanding simulation frameworks.
- 2. Python Programming Fundamentals: Learners will explore core Python programming concepts, including variables, data types, control structures, and functions. They will develop basic programming skills necessary for building simulation environments.
- 3. Object-Oriented Programming in Python: Learners will delve into object-oriented programming principles and their application in Python. They will learn to write reusable code and create complex simulation models.
- 4. Numerical Methods and Algorithms: Learners will study numerical methods and algorithms used in simulation, including linear algebra, optimization techniques, and numerical integration. They will implement these techniques in Python.
- 5. Real-Time Data Processing with Python: Learners will learn how to process and analyze real-time data efficiently using Python. They will gain skills in data streaming, data manipulation, and real-time analytics.
- 6. Building Simulation Models: Learners will create and design simulation models using Python. They will apply learned programming and numerical methods to build and test simulation models.
- 7. Visualization and Data Presentation: Learners will learn to visualize simulation data using Python libraries such as Matplotlib and Plotly. They will develop skills in presenting simulation results effectively.
- 8. Advanced Topics in Simulation: Learners will explore advanced topics in simulation, including stochastic processes, agent-based modeling, and system dynamics. They will apply these concepts to enhance their simulation models.
- 9. Real-Time Simulation Deployment: Learners will learn how to deploy and integrate real-time simulation environments into real-world applications. They will understand the technical and practical aspects of simulation deployment.
- 10. Project Development and Presentation: Learners will work on a comprehensive project to develop a real-time simulation environment. They will present their project and receive feedback from peers and instructors.
